The Training Coordinatorwill be responsible for the daily administration and coordination of training functions and events.
- Originate, update, and maintain all Training department related calendars. Initiate internal and external calendar invites for guest speakers and class participants. Reserve room(s) as appropriate, manage training room reservations.
- Administrator of Learning Management System (LMS). Duties include but are not limited to the following:
1. Create, maintain, and update data as appropriate.
2. Create, maintain, and assign web and instructor-led based courses per class curriculums. Monitor class participants completion of assigned courses.
3. Update class rosters as needed. Support users with password and course resets, following internal guidelines.
- Responsible for sending updates and reminders to class participants and corresponding leaders.
- Monitor daily new hire additions or deletions and send appropriate status updates to the Training department. Originate new hire updates to respective leaders and complete pertinent new hire activities in a timely manner.
- Maintain corporate library inventory, process check out requests, initiate appropriate communications related to past due resources. Verify all library resources have been returned from employees who are leaving employment with the Credit Union.
- Complete monthly update of user ID passwords in the core system and loan origination system (LOS) test environments.
- Track office supplies needed; provide request list to AVP Training and Leadership Development.
